Babar, Sadaqat Shine as Zalmi Hand United Another Blow

Share the latest news updates

Peshawar Zalmi kept their playoff hopes alive in PSL 2025 with a dominant six-wicket win over Islamabad United in Lahore. A brilliant all-round bowling effort restricted United to just 143 for 9 before Babar Azam and Maaz Sadaqat guided Zalmi to victory with composed half-centuries.

Bowlers Set the Tone

After losing the toss, Zalmi delivered one of the best bowling performances of the season. Mohammad Ali led the charge with 3 for 26, while every frontline bowler kept things tight and took wickets. Despite Islamabad reaching 57 without loss in the powerplay, their innings lost momentum quickly.

Sahibzada Farhan’s slow 36 off 35 balls hurt United’s tempo. Once he fell in the eighth over, the collapse began. Kyle Mayers added 18 but couldn’t accelerate. Salman Ali Agha was dismissed by a clever carrom ball from Saim Ayub, and United’s middle order faltered badly.

Adding to their woes, captain Shadab Khan had to leave the field with a suspected hip injury after a short-lived eight-ball cameo. Zalmi’s part-timers, Ayub and Hussain Talat, applied pressure by conceding just 30 runs in their combined four overs. United limped to 143, far below a challenging total.

Babar, Sadaqat Lead Calm Chase

Zalmi’s chase didn’t start smoothly. They lost Mitchell Owen, Saim Ayub, and Mohammad Haris early, falling to 38 for 3. Babar Azam initially looked uncertain at the crease, but Sadaqat’s confident strokeplay settled the nerves.

The duo added 102 runs, with Sadaqat hitting elegant boundaries and Babar anchoring the innings. As United’s bowlers faded, Babar found his rhythm. He struck Naseem Shah over mid-off and cruised to his second fifty of the season. Though Sadaqat fell late in the chase, Max Bryant finished the job with ease.

United in Trouble

United’s second consecutive loss raises serious concerns. Their batting lacked intensity, and the absence of Shadab adds to their problems. Meanwhile, Zalmi’s balanced effort—sharp bowling and smart batting—keeps them in the playoff hunt and builds momentum at a crucial time.
